Frequently Asked Questions
How much does it cost to live in Kutaisi in 2026?
A single expat living in central Kutaisi should budget approximately €599 per month, covering rent, groceries, transport, utilities, healthcare, and entertainment. A family of four needs around €1,199/month.
How much is rent in Kutaisi for expats?
A 1-bedroom apartment in Kutaisi city centre costs around €300/month. Outside the centre, expect to pay approximately €204/month. A 3-bedroom apartment in the centre is around €660/month.
